Robert Decker

Robert “Star” Decker, 69, of Mayville, died Tuesday, June 12, 2018 at his home.

Bob was born January 19, 1949 in Beaver Dam the son of LeRoy and Norma Vande Zande Decker.  Bob grew up in Fox Lake and graduated from Waupun High School. On October 21, 1972 he married Rene Williams in Fox Lake.  They resided in Fox Lake until 1986 and then moved to Mayville. Bob retired from Tab Products in Mayville. He was a veteran of the United States Army and served two tours of duty in Vietnam as a medic.  He attended First Christian Reformed Church in Waupun. Bob was an avid sportsman and enjoyed a variety of activities.

Bob is survived by three children: Derek (Danyelle) Decker of Appleton, Daniel (Sara) Decker of Mayville, and Darcey (Mike) Anderson of Leroy; nine grandchildren: Briana, Brady, Brooklyn, Paxton, Sullivan, Crosby, Addison, Jackson, and Hudson; three brothers: Terry (Kathy) Decker of Waupun, Mike (Marcia) Decker of Beaver Dam, and Vince (Ellen) Decker of Waupun; a sister, Gale (Oscar) Hartwig of Horicon; nieces and nephews; and his special long-time friend of 27 years, Debbie Mulder of Mayville.

Bob was preceded in death by his parents.
